site stats

Sqlalchemy getting started

WebThe first step in writing SQLAlchemy code is to open a connection to the database you'll be using. In SQLAlchemy, this is done by creating an SQLEngine object, which knows how to … WebNov 18, 2016 · First we'll import the sqlite3library and make a connection to a database file: import sqlite3 conn = sqlite3.connect('database.db') Learn Data Science with With that one line we have created the database.dbfile in our directory and made a connection, which now use to run SQL queries.

Create a REST API in Python with Flask and SQLAlchemy

WebTo create the initial database, just import the db object from an interactive Python shell and run the SQLAlchemy.create_all () method to create the tables and database: >>> from yourapplication import db >>> db.create_all() Boom, and there is your database. Now to create some users: WebMar 21, 2024 · SQLAlchemy for absolute beginners Lynn Kwong in Python in Plain English How to Handle Errors and Exceptions Properly in Python Ahmed Besbes in Towards Data … how to mark gmail as read https://phillybassdent.com

Databases in Python Made Easy with SQLAlchemy - DEV Community

WebNov 9, 2024 · To create an engine and start interacting with databases, we have to import the create_engine function from the sqlalchemy library and issue a call to it: from sqlalchemy import create_engine engine = create_engine('postgresql://usr:pass@localhost:5432/sqlalchemy') WebA 'SQLAlchemy' instance has already been registered on this Flask app On my website, I already successfully created a Flask App running with SQLAlchemy, say on mywebsite.com/test1 There is 2 files : "main.py" import sys import os from flask import Flask, ... python flask sqlalchemy flask-sqlalchemy Bitoubi 116 asked 14 hours ago 0 … WebMay 15, 2024 · SQLAlchemy can serve two purposes: making SQL interactions easier, and serving as a full-blown ORM. Even if you aren't interested in implementing an ORM (or don't know what an ORM is), SQLAlchemy is invaluable as a tool to simplify connections to SQL databases and performing raw queries. how to marinate chicken at home

Tutorial — Alembic 1.10.3 documentation - SQLAlchemy

Category:Using PostgreSQL through SQLAlchemy - Compose Articles

Tags:Sqlalchemy getting started

Sqlalchemy getting started

How to Use Flask-SQLAlchemy to Interact with Databases

WebSep 23, 2024 · SQLAlchemy for absolute beginners Michael Krasnov in Better Programming A Hands-On Guide to Concurrency in Python With Asyncio Timothy Mugayi in Better … WebThe SQLAlchemy Reference Documentation is by far the most important place for both the newest user and the veteran alchemist. The Reference Documentation represents an …

Sqlalchemy getting started

Did you know?

WebApr 12, 2024 · sqlalchemy basic usage 2024-04-12. Define tables: from sqlalchemy import create_engine, inspect, Column, Integer, String, ForeignKey from sqlalchemy.orm import relationship, sessionmaker from sqlalchemy.ext.declarative import declarative_base # 1. WebESSS / flask-restalchemy / flask_restalchemy / serialization / datetimeserializer.py View on Github. def is_datetime_field(col): """ Check if a column is DateTime (or implements DateTime) :param Column col: the column object to be checked :rtype: bool """ if hasattr (col. type, "impl" ): return type (col. type .impl) is DateTime else : return ...

WebInstall SQLAlchemy It is fairly easy to install the package and get started with coding. You can install SQLAlchemy using the Python Package Manager (pip): pip install sqlalchemy In case, you are using the Anaconda distribution of Python, try to enter the command in conda terminal: conda install - c anaconda sqlalchemy WebNov 16, 2024 · Getting Started Grab the Prerequisites Add New Dependencies Check Your Flask Project Initializing the Database Inspect Your Current Data Structure Conceptualize Your Database Table Build Your Database Interact With the Database Connecting the SQLite Database With Your Flask Project Configure Your Database Model Data With SQLAlchemy

http://www.rmunn.com/sqlalchemy-tutorial/tutorial.html WebFlask-SQLAlchemy - Flask extension that provides SQLAlchemy support; Flask-Migrate - extension that supports SQLAlchemy database migrations via Alembic; To get started, install Postgres on your local computer, if you don’t have it already. Since Heroku uses Postgres, it will be good for us to develop locally on the same database.

WebSep 12, 2024 · SQLAlchemy is a toolkit that simplifies working with databases by creating and optimizing the SQL statements for you. This is accomplished by using the Object …

WebMar 9, 2024 · Flask-SQLAlchemy is a Flask extension that makes using SQLAlchemy with Flask easier, providing you tools and methods to interact with your database in your Flask … how to mark property cornersWebNov 22, 2016 · Getting started with using SQLAlchemy can seem pretty daunting, as a lot of the documentation and tutorials assume a fairly high level of familiarity with what SQLAlchemy is, what it does, and how it works. In this article, I'll show how you can use SQLAlchemy at three different layers of abstraction. how to marinate shrimp kabobsWebInstallation Install prefect-sqlalchemy with pip: pip install prefect-sqlalchemy Requires an installation of Python 3.7+. We recommend using a Python virtual environment manager such as pipenv, conda or virtualenv. These tasks are designed to work with Prefect 2.0. how to marry in esoWebAug 14, 2024 · SQLAlchemy is a Python SQL toolkit and Object Relational Mapper (ORM). In today’s post, we will look at how the ORM part can be leverage to easily create and … how to market for a small businessWebSQLAlchemy is most famous for its object-relational mapper (ORM), an optional component that provides the data mapper pattern, where classes can be mapped to the database in … how to master reset the moxee hotspotWebThe first step in writing SQLAlchemy code is to open a connection to the database you'll be using. In SQLAlchemy, this is done by creating an SQLEngine object, which knows how to talk to one particular type of database (SQLite, PostgreSQL, Firebird, MySQL, Oracle...). The SQLEngine object also doubles as a connection object. how to match wall texture repairhow to maximise avios